Property Tax Information


Tax bills are mailed out in mid-December.
First installments (or full payments) are due on or before January 31.

Include the correct stub from the lower portion of the tax bill with your payment.  Allow a minimum of 7 business days for mailing and 7 business days for bank processing.  If you require a receipt, you must include a self-addressed stamped envelope.  NO CASH PAYMENTS will be accepted. Checks or Money Orders only.

Make Checks Payable to Town of Marshfield and send payment to:
Town of Marshfield
Catherine A. Seibel, Treasurer
W2173 County Road W
Mt. Calvary, WI 53057-9523

OR

Use the drop-box at the Town Hall, located inside the east entrance.

Second installment payment is payable on or before July 31 to Fond du Lac County Treasurer. Second installment payment or any payment made after January 31 is made payable to Fond du Lac County Treasurer and is sent to:

Fond du Lac County Treasurer
160 South Macy Street
P.O. Box 1515
Fond du Lac, WI 54935

Do not mail second installation payments or late payments to the Town of Marshfield Treasurer. 
All payments made after January 31 are handled by the County Treasurer only.
Town of Marshfield Treasurer can only process payments postmarked by January 31.

Land Notification

Real estate and mortgage fraud are growing crimes in America today. Monitor your property with Land Notification

What is Land Notification? Land Notification alerts warn property owners when documents are recorded against his/her personal or business name OR an identified Parcel Identification Number (PIN).  Each time an alert is triggered, an email is sent providing an update of any activity.
